The Western Balkans Investment Framework (WBIF)
The Western Balkans Investment Framework (WBIF) stands as a significant financial instrument designed to bolster socio-economic development and accelerate the European integration process across the Western Balkans region. It functions as a collaborative platform, pooling grant resources from the European Union, individual EU member states, and other donors to support strategic investments in infrastructure, energy efficiency, and the private sector.
The WBIF’s primary objective is to attract further investment into the region, fostering sustainable growth and improving the lives of citizens. By providing grant funding, the WBIF de-risks projects, making them more appealing to both public and private sector investors. This catalytic effect is crucial in overcoming the investment challenges inherent in emerging markets, particularly in countries with limited access to capital and often perceived higher risk profiles.
Infrastructure projects are a cornerstone of the WBIF’s activities. The fund supports the construction and rehabilitation of vital transport links, including roads, railways, and ports. These improvements are essential for facilitating trade, connecting communities, and promoting regional integration. Furthermore, the WBIF invests in energy infrastructure, focusing on renewable energy sources and energy efficiency measures. This contributes to a more sustainable energy future for the region, reducing reliance on fossil fuels and mitigating climate change.
Beyond infrastructure, the WBIF actively supports private sector development, recognizing its critical role in job creation and economic growth. This support takes various forms, including grants for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s), technical assistance to improve business competitiveness, and guarantees to encourage lending to entrepreneurs. By fostering a vibrant and dynamic private sector, the WBIF aims to create a more prosperous and resilient economy in the Western Balkans.
The WBIF operates through a rigorous project selection process, ensuring that investments align with regional priorities and contribute to sustainable development. Projects are assessed based on their economic viability, environmental impact, and social benefits. The framework also emphasizes good governance and transparency, ensuring that funds are used effectively and accountably.
